ACE studies (and kids)

ACE---Adverse Childhood Experience

I thought that this forum might be a good place to give a link to the ACE study website.
It deals with many of the subjects that are discussed in many of the threads....such as stress and illness connection....stress on the children who are exposed to alcoholism in the home....or, witnessing parental fighting, etc.....
what constitutes an adverse experience....and what contributes to resilience?

Useful for thinking about our own childhoods....as well as t hat of our own children...…

dandylion,

Thanks for posting this. ACEs has recently come on my radar because my youngest son has been acting out so much at school. I have done so much research on it in the last couple months.

I wish the school would catch up with this information. My youngest son's teacher made a group table at school with 4 boys who all have lives with severe ACEs and wonders why they are ALWAYS in trouble.....

My younger son has soooo much guilt because of speaking out about his AF. He has stomach issues quite a bit as a result. Its hard being on this teeter totter. Thank God for good counselors.

Thanks for getting the word out to other parents. I believe this is such an important topic.
